0
点赞
收藏
分享

微信扫一扫

java 定位对象

Java 定位对象的实现

在Java开发中,我们经常需要定位和操作特定的对象。定位对象是指通过代码找到我们需要操作的对象,然后对其进行相应的处理。本文将介绍Java中定位对象的实现方法,并且详细讲解每一步需要做什么以及相应的代码示例。

定位对象的实现流程

下面是定位对象的实现流程,我们可以使用一个表格来展示每个步骤。

步骤 描述
步骤1 导入相关的包
步骤2 创建对象
步骤3 对象定位
步骤4 对对象进行操作

接下来,我们将逐步详细讲解每个步骤应该做什么,以及相应的代码示例。

步骤1:导入相关的包

在Java中,我们需要导入一些相关的包来使用定位对象所需要的类和方法。最常用的定位对象的类是java.util下的ArrayListjava.util下的HashMap。通过导入相关的包,我们可以使用这些类来实现定位对象。

import java.util.ArrayList;
import java.util.HashMap;

步骤2:创建对象

在定位对象之前,我们需要先创建对象。对象是Java中的一种基本的数据结构,用于表示特定类型的实例。我们可以使用new关键字来创建对象,并且根据需要,可以将其赋值给一个变量。

ArrayList<String> list = new ArrayList<>();
HashMap<String, Integer> map = new HashMap<>();

上面的示例代码创建了一个ArrayList对象和一个HashMap对象,分别存储字符串和整数类型的数据。

步骤3:对象定位

一旦对象被创建,我们可以使用不同的方法来定位它。对象定位的方式取决于对象的类型和应用需求。以下是一些常见的对象定位方法:

  • 通过索引定位:对于ArrayList对象,我们可以使用索引来定位特定的元素。索引从0开始,表示第一个元素,依次递增。通过索引定位对象的代码示例如下:
String element = list.get(0);

上面的代码使用get方法和索引0来获取ArrayList对象中的第一个元素。

  • 通过键值对定位:对于HashMap对象,我们可以使用键值对来定位特定的元素。键值对由键和值组成,我们可以通过键来找到对应的值。通过键值对定位对象的代码示例如下:
Integer value = map.get("key");

上面的代码使用get方法和键"key"来获取HashMap对象中对应的值。

步骤4:对对象进行操作

一旦对象被定位,我们可以对其进行相应的操作。操作的方式取决于对象的类型和应用需求。以下是一些常见的对象操作方法:

  • 修改对象:通过定位对象后,我们可以直接修改对象的值或状态。具体的操作方式取决于对象的类型和目标。
list.set(0, "new element");

上面的代码使用set方法和索引0来修改ArrayList对象中的第一个元素。

map.put("key", 123);

上面的代码使用put方法和键"key"来修改HashMap对象中对应的值。

  • 删除对象:有时候我们需要从对象中删除特定的元素。具体的操作方式取决于对象的类型和目标。
list.remove(0);

上面的代码使用remove方法和索引0来删除ArrayList对象中的第一个元素。

map.remove("key");

上面的代码使用remove方法和键"key"来删除HashMap对象中对应的键值对。

至此,我们已经完成了Java中定位对象的实现方法的讲解。通过以上的步骤和代码示例,我们可以清晰地了解到如何定位和操作特定的对象。

总结起来,定位对象的实现步

举报

相关推荐

0 条评论